Transaction

098d65473bf4bbd03efd4fbc41441f06e70e5e7fa4ad059b8da3f0c93913890e
576,294 confirmations
Timestamp
1436914067
Block365,337
Fee30,000 sats
Fee rate44.9 sats/vB
view on mempool.space

Inputs & Outputs